Jan 31, Peradeniya: None of the nursing staff members of the Peradeniya hospital have reported to work despite yesterday's court orders to halt their trade union action, hospital sources said.
However, the doctors and the minor staff continued the services to the residential and out patients to the best of their ability, the sources added.
Kandy Magistrate, Sumudu Premachandra, yesterday ordered the 32 members of the hospital’s nursing staff to halt the strike action and to adhere to the recommendations provided by the Health Ministry on the issue.
The nursing staff went on a strike five days ago on a dispute over a use of a staff room with the doctors.
